Toddler Bedroom Furniture Sets


Toddler bedroom furniture sets have to fulfill some lofty requirements. From concerns about durability to safety issues, dressing up your child’s bedroom can be very fun, but also way more work than you expected. Going from a practical perspective, toddler’s furniture has to be cute and durable at the same time. It has to be able to withstand a beating without either breaking or becoming a hazard to your child. Whether you want sporty and cool design, or just a sunny and bright appearance, you need to keep in mind a few factors whenever you are looking to remodel or set up the furniture in your kid’s bedroom. Here are some top tips to help you through.

1.Safety first

Safety should always be a priority when you are shopping for toddler bedroom furniture sets. Everything you buy should have a level of protection, which is sometimes indicated on the item depending on the age of your toddler. You should never go for furniture that’s made from flimsy materials and those that have sporting sharp edges with visible loose components. Such items can be potentially life threatening to your kid.

2. Furniture made specifically for a child

You need to understand that kids don’t just use the furniture for the intended purposes. Whether it’s the desks, bed, chairs or dressers, they tend to give them a heck of a beating. It won’t be surprising finding your 2-year-old toddler climbing their cribs or using their beds as trampolines: they punish their furnishings. For this reason, you should always ensure that the furniture you buy is designed specifically for a child. The design has to be sound and sturdy, and the sizing has to be right.

3. Abundant storage

Kids tend to accumulate a lot of stuff in a very short time. Whether it’s a chest, under-bed storage or closet, chances are that you will soon realize you don’t have enough space to stick your child’s belongings. It is difficult to teach your toddler how to be organized if the room itself doesn’t have effective storage. You can get adjustable closet storage where you can keep the discolored dolls, stuffed elephants or even those sexy outfits for your child.

4. Longevity

Fine, you love the race car beds and want to purchase one for your two-year old. What you may not know is that it’s cute now, but in one or two years the fun aspect will gradually wear thin. Well, there is nothing wrong with buying a race car bed for your toddler, but you must ensure that it’s durable enough to stand the test of time without the need to replace before your kid turns four. Go for toddler bedroom furniture sets that will last longer, and this means resisting pieces made from molded plastic.

5. Stability

You can never rule out the fact that your kid may tips and fall while playing in their bedroom. You will not want to have unstable furniture that may make your child keep on falling. In order to prevent tipping, get wider based and sturdy items that are more stable. You can test the furniture before purchasing and get those that are difficult to tip over.

6. Always go for renowned manufacturers

Every year there are reports on dozen of kid’s products that result in injuries, and in the worst cases, fatalities. All this is attributed to unsafe goods. You should always buy your toddler bedroom furniture sets from manufacturers you can trust. Don’t hesitate to read reviews of that particular product and see what customers have to say. If anything seems off to you, don’t buy it! Contact the manufacturer if you have to and stay informed about the furniture you are about to purchase.
